Ecotourism, as the name implies, is a tourism activity that is oriented towards absorbing natural and cultural knowledge, minimizing the adverse impact on the ecological environment, ensuring the sustainable use of tourism resources, and integrating ecological environmental protection and public education with the promotion of local economic and social development.    

    

Ecotourism is a kind of tourism in which the ecological environment is the main landscape. It refers to the ecotourism experience, the ecological education, the ecological cognition and the pleasures of the mind, which are carried out in a friendly way, based on the ecological environment and the unique human ecological system, and based on the premise of the sustainable development and the harmonious development of human beings and nature.    

    

Alright, it sounds like an overbearing act. To put it bluntly, ecotourism is a natural tourism. It is a way of using nature to protect and develop nature.
